JLR opens bookings for Land Rover Defender
Jaguar Land Rover India has opened bookings of the New Land Rover Defender in India. Offered with a 2.0 l,221 kW (300PS) petrol powertrain with 400 Nm of torque, the New Defender will be available in two distinct body styles, the elegant 90 (3door) and the versatile 110 (5door) as a Completely Built Unit (CBU) and is priced from Rs69.99 lakh (ex-showroom India).

To fill the regulatory vacuum in quality certification space for medical devices in the country, a major industry awareness workshop on Quality Council of India’s Voluntary Certification System on “Indian Certification for Medical Devices (ICMED)” -Incentivising Quality in Healthcare Products was conducted in New Delhi on February 28. The workshop was held under the aegis of Department of Pharmaceuticals, supported by CDSCO, BCIL, AIMED and industry members.
